Distribution for a facility like Hearthside McComb involves a complex orchestration of logistics. Contracted trucking companies navigate highways, transporting pallets of finished goods to warehouses strategically located near major population centers. These warehouses serve as temporary holding points, consolidating products from multiple manufacturers before dispersing them to individual retail outlets. The efficiency of this process hinges on factors such as accurate inventory management, timely delivery schedules, and the ability to adapt to unexpected disruptions, like inclement weather or transportation delays. The perishable nature of some food products adds another layer of complexity, requiring refrigerated trucks and strict temperature controls to maintain product freshness and prevent spoilage. For example, if the plant produces frozen waffles, specialized refrigerated distribution channels are essential to ensure the waffles arrive at grocery stores in a frozen state, preserving their quality and safety.

Question 1: What is the primary function of the Hearthside Food Solutions facility in McComb, Ohio?
The McComb plant operates as a contract manufacturer. This means it produces food items for other companies who then market and sell those products under their own brand names. The plant itself does not typically sell directly to consumers.
Question 2: Does the McComb facility handle only one type of food product?
Likely not. Contract manufacturing facilities often handle a diverse range of products to meet the varying needs of their clients. This could include snack bars, baked goods, or other processed food items, depending on the contracts Hearthside has secured.
